Solid Edge Framework Type Library
MatTable Object Members
Overview 
Public Methods
Public Method AddCustomPropertyAdds the custom property for input material.
Public Method AddMaterialAdds material to material library.
Public Method AddMaterialToFavoritesAdds the input material to the list of favorite materials.
Public Method AddMaterialToLibrary
Public Method ApplyMaterialThis API is used to apply specific material for a document.
Public Method ApplyMaterialToDocThis method will apply material from given library to the document.
Public Method ClearMRUListClears the current MRU list.
Public Method CreateNewDirectoryCreates an empty directory at specified level in the library
Public Method CreateNewMaterialLibraryThis API will create a new material library.
Public Method DeleteCustomPropertyDeletes the custom property of a material.
Public Method DeleteDirectory
Public Method DeleteMaterialDeletes material from library.
Public Method DeleteMaterialFromLibraryDeletes input material from specified library.
Public Method EditOpenGageExcelFileThis method is used to open the Gage file for editing.
Public Method ExportMaterialDataToFileWrites out all the material data of input material library into XML or EXCEL file.
Public Method GetCountOfCustomPropertiesReturns the count of custom properties of a material from specified library.
Public Method GetCurrentGageNameThis method is used to fetch the name of currently applied gage of a sheet metal document.
Public Method GetCurrentMaterialNameThis method is used to fetch the name of currently applied material of a sheet metal document.
Public Method GetCustomMaterialPropertyFromDocThis method will return custom property for input material from specified document.
Public Method GetCustomMaterialPropertyFromLibraryThis method will return custom property for input material from specified library.
Public Method GetDefaultGageFileNameThis method is used to get the complete path of the gage excel file.
Public Method GetFavoriteMaterialListReturns the list of favorite materials and their corresponding libraries.
Public Method GetMaterialLibraryFileListReturns the list containing full path of material libraries in materials folder.
Public Method GetMaterialLibraryListReturns the list containing only names of material libraries in materials folder.
Public Method GetMaterialListReturns material list from library.
Public Method GetMaterialListFromLibraryThis API will return the list of materials from a specific library. The library can be full path or only name of the library file.
Public Method GetMaterialPropValueFromDocReturn Material's property from input document.
Public Method GetMaterialPropValueFromLibraryReturns the property value of a material from specified library.
Public Method GetMaterialsFolderPathReturns the material library folder path.
Public Method GetMatLibFileNameReturns material library name.
Public Method GetMatPropValueReturns material property value.
Public Method GetMRUMaterialLimitReturns the current limit of MRU materials.
Public Method GetMRUMaterialListReturns the list of most recently used materials and their corresponding libraries.
Public Method GetPSMGaugeInfoForDocThis API is used to get all the gage related information from a sheet metal document.
Public Method GetPSMGaugeListFromExcelThis method is used to obtain list of Gages from a Gage table.
Public Method ImportMaterialDataFromFileOverwrites all the data of input material library with data from XML or EXCEL file.
Public Method PerformGageDataValidationThis method is used to validate a Gage for data integrity.
Public Method RenameDirectoryRenames existing directory with new name.
Public Method RenameLibraryRenames existing library with new name.
Public Method RenameMaterialRenames the input material with new name.
Public Method SetActiveDocument
Public Method SetDocumentToGageTableAssociationThis method will create an association between the sheet metal file and the Gage table.
Public Method SetMaterialPropValueToLibrarySets the value for property of a material from specified library.
Public Method SetMaterialsFolderPath
Public Method SetMaterialToGageTableAssociationThis method is used to create an association between a material and a Gage table.
Public Method SetMatPropValueSets material property value.
Public Method SetMRUMaterialLimitSets the limit value for MRU materials.
Public Method UseNeutralFactorFromExcelThis method is used to decide source of the Neutral Factor.
Public Method WriteMaterialDataToXMLWrites material table data to XML file.
Public Method WriteMatLibFileFromXML
See Also

MatTable Object  | Solid Edge V17 - What's New